We propose to observe the bright X-ray source Cyg X-2 as an ideal candidate to study the chemistry of the diffuse Interstellar Medium (ISM). We will study the two phases of ISM (gas and dust) through spectroscopy of the absorbed spectrum and the spectral and spatial analysis of the X-ray dust scattering halo. The study of the scattering halo of Cyg X-2 unveiled for the first time features from the ID constituents. To perform a quantitative measurement of the chemistry of the Interstellar Dust (ID) grains a large collective area, a large field of view, and a broad band coverage, like the one provided by XMM, is needed.
